The Premier League returns today and Arsenal will tonight take on Newcastle United at the Emirates Stadium with the hope of continuing their winning streak that they have started post 2022 World Cup. Arsenal manager Mikel Arteta will once again have to pick his best starting eleven that can get the three points and we take a look at that possible team he might select with all eyes on Gabriel Martinelli & Bukayo Saka.
PREDICTED ARSENAL LINEUP TO FACE NEWCASTLE UNITED
Predicted Arsenal lineup to face Newcastle United
TEXT FORMAT: Ramsdale, Zinchenko, Gabriel, Saliba, White, Xhaka, Partey, Martinelli, Odegaard, Saka, Nketiah
FORMATION: 4-2-3-1
GOALKEEPING
Aaron Ramsdale will be in goal today despite conceding in the previous game because he is Arteta’s first choice.
DEFENCE
If it ain’t broke, why fix it? The defence consisting of Zinchenko, Gabriel, Saliba and White has been Arsenal’s best defence in a while, and so Arteta will continue using it.
CENTRAL MIDFIELD
Thomas Partey and Granit Xhaka have been rock solid together for Arsenal this season and they will never miss in Mikel Arteta’s squad.
ATTACKING MIDFIELD
Gabriel Martinelli and Bukayo Saka have been Arsenal’s best performing players this season and all eyes will be on them as they are the current star players. Martinelli and Saka will be on the flanks while Martin Odegaard will be the central attacking midfielder.
STRIKING
Eddie Nketiah has taken over after the injury of Gabriel Jesus and so he will likely start as centre forward against Newcastle United.
